Many tax preparers provide a flat fee service, while others might charge hourly. It's essential to discuss pricing upfront and understand what services are included in the fee. Some preparers may offer additional services like tax planning or audit support for an added fee, which can be beneficial depending on your needs.

Essential documents typically include W-2 forms, 1099s, receipts for deductions, previous tax returns, and information on any investments or business income. Organized documents can expedite the preparation process significantly.

Understanding the Importance of Tax Deductions Tax deductions are expenses that you can subtract from your total income to reduce your taxable income. Understanding the significance of these deductions is fundamental for anyone looking to minimize their tax burden. For instance, if you are a small business owner, the ability to deduct operational expenses, such as supplies, mileage, and even a portion of your home for a home office, can lead to substantial savings.

Navigating Tax Disputes Efficiently In the unfortunate event of a tax dispute or audit, having a CPA who knows the ins and outs of tax law can be invaluable. They can represent you before the IRS and work to resolve any discrepancies efficiently. For instance, if you received a notice about additional taxes owed, a CPA can help analyze the situation and provide a well-argued response to the IRS.
